Address

ecash:qqyz356gk78hxpsce5hfz2qjgpyc9uzvq54drn7ut5Copy

Total Received

4610.81 XEC

Total Sent

0 XEC

№ Transactions

50

Final Balance

4610.81 XEC

Transactions
Filter